Praia da Figueira is located on the
South Atlantic Ocean (part of Atlantic ocean) and it is in the
158th place out of 228 beaches in the
São Paulo region
143.1 km away from its center, the city of
Sao Paulo. It is one of the beaches of
Castelhanos settlement, just
3.1 km from its center.
The beach is
located in a natural place.
It is a spacious bay with crystal turquoise water and bright sand,
so you don't need special shoes. The entrance to the water is very smooth. This beach is suitable for different
categories of people, lonely travellers, relaxation getaway lovers, hikers
etc.
It is not crowded place during the season.
Praia da Figueira coast is free for all. It has no amenities, only nature. .

Praia da Figueira (São Paulo)
is located outside the Castelhanos
settlement, which may cause some difficulties
for travelers who stay far from the coast.
However, the remoteness from the village is not always a bad thing. Lovers of quiet rest know,
the farther the beach, the fewer crowds.
The beach stretches on the
coast of the Ilhabela island
and the correct question is not how to get to Praia da Figueira, but what mode of transport can be used
to get to it,
because this part of the coast is inaccessible by land. The beach can only be reached by water and
you have to rent a boat to get there.
